Opened on 11/11/2015 at 08:43:54 AM

Closed on 01/08/2016 at 06:20:13 PM

Last modified on 12/15/2016 at 06:18:30 AM

#3300 closed defect (fixed)

Facebook preview images not showing

Reported by: arthur Assignee:
Priority: P3 Milestone: Adblock-Plus-for-Internet-Explorer-1.6
Module: Adblock-Plus-for-Internet-Explorer Keywords:
Cc: sergz, oleksandr Blocked By: #3303, #3343
Blocking: Platform: Internet Explorer
Ready: no Confidential: no
Tester: Rraceanu Verified working: yes
Review URL(s):

Description

Environment

ABP 1.5
EasyList enabled
IE 11.0.10240.16431
Windows 10

How to reproduce

  1. Go to https://www.facebook.com/AnimalEqualityGermany/posts/954896191250874

Observed behaviour

The preview image in the post is showing for a split second (when refreshing via Ctrl+F5) and then disappears. Disabling ABP for facebook.com makes it appear again.

Expected behaviour

The image should always show.

Attachments (0)

Change History (11)

comment:1 Changed on 11/11/2015 at 03:29:34 PM by sergz

It's blocked by CPluginDomTraverser, for img tags it checks whether the request in src should be blocked or not and hides the element if src is blocked. In this particular case the URL is https://external-frt3-1.xx.fbcdn.net/safe_image.php?d=AQDG18hXt4a9ZX9b&w=470&h=246&url=https://www.facebook.com/ads/image/?d=AQLBPIefFK_mcLEvFR-mVwHgciv-NMbof-t6UHSCX76geZci_sFNFvKnjbX5wekR58St4JQM8Gyb5uC2HL_4JEAr21I9_kSY_cS9ZDopWQKqpfarzLe_AApWcqjl4T0-YgngkHPjujuuMiYlfkl_urqt&cfs=1&upscale=1 and the corresponding blocking filter is /ads/image/*.

FYI: #3303.

The question is, how to fix it?

comment:2 Changed on 11/12/2015 at 11:42:16 AM by sergz

Interesting that neither in Firefox nor in Chrome the URL seems to be not decoded before matching the filter, so it is the reason it's not blocked there.

comment:3 Changed on 11/16/2015 at 04:12:35 AM by oleksandr

  • Priority changed from Unknown to P3
  • Ready set

Chrome uridecodes the address part of the URL, leaving the query string intact. We should do the same.

comment:4 Changed on 11/16/2015 at 09:22:01 PM by oleksandr

  • Blocked By 3303 added

comment:5 Changed on 11/16/2015 at 09:22:18 PM by oleksandr

  • Ready unset

comment:6 Changed on 11/23/2015 at 02:34:28 PM by oleksandr

  • Blocked By 3343 added

comment:7 Changed on 01/08/2016 at 05:27:48 PM by eric@adblockplus.org

We've retired #3343. Did that change fix this problem?

comment:8 Changed on 01/08/2016 at 06:20:13 PM by oleksandr

  • Resolution set to fixed
  • Status changed from new to closed

Yes, it seems like it is fixed now, based on my tests. This should be included in the next devbuild and ABP for IE 1.6

comment:9 Changed on 01/11/2016 at 02:51:21 PM by oleksandr

  • Milestone set to Adblock-Plus-for-Internet-Explorer-Next

comment:10 Changed on 11/08/2016 at 12:59:49 AM by rraceanu

  • Tester changed from Unknown to Rraceanu

comment:11 Changed on 12/01/2016 at 01:30:46 AM by rraceanu

  • Verified working set

Fix implemented successfully on ABP for IE 1.5.856 for IE 11.447.14393.0 and IE 11.103.14393.0 Windows 10 Home and Pro, also IE 10 on Windows 8, preview thumbnails load correctly.

Last edited on 12/15/2016 at 06:18:30 AM by rraceanu

Add Comment

Modify Ticket

Change Properties
Action
as closed .
The resolution will be deleted. Next status will be 'reopened'.
to The owner will be changed from (none).
 
Note: See TracTickets for help on using tickets.